About Gilgit-Baltistan's Mineral Wealth

Gilgit-Baltistan sits at the confluence of multiple mountain ranges and geological formations, creating unique conditions for diverse mineral formation. The region's complex geology, shaped by the collision of tectonic plates, has produced world-class mineral deposits recognized internationally.

From sapphires and rubies to rare gemstones and metallic minerals like magnetite, pyrite, galena, and chalcopyrite, the region represents one of the world's most important sources of high-quality minerals.
